Back End Developer

Application deadline date has been passed for this Job.
This job has been Expired
Full Time
  • Employer: PepperStone
Job Description

The Pepperstone story started in 2010. Our team describes us as a place for the creative and the driven. We’re a team who do things a little differently: we’re a global fintech that was born digital, nimble, connected, and united in our purpose to truly support every one of our customers’ quests for trading mastery. Our people are motivated to develop their careers in FinTech in a vibrant and fast-paced environment. We thrive on progress – for our traders and for ourselves. We possess a unique organisational culture, combined with a vibrant and fast-paced working environment for driven people who want to grow their career in finance and do so with one of the world’s fastest-growing FX brokers.

The Role

We’re growing our team and are looking for mid-level and senior Back End Developers. These are exciting opportunities to join a growing team within the IT department at a global organisation as we head into a digital transformation.

Your days will include:

  • Developing integrations & components for trading platforms
  • Managing performance and optimisation of our trading platforms
  • Working closely with the product function to continue to build out new functionalities
  • Structuring UI into composable and unit-tested components.
  • Writing unit, automation, and performance tests and integrating work into a CI/CD pipeline for deployment in line with our development guidelines
  • Working with the architecture team and development operations to design and deploy systems for use in the business
  • Contribute to architecture and design in collaborating with the Engineering Chapter Lead
  • Ensuring that development and design principles are followed
  • Contributing to the improvement of software development lifecycle processes
  • Working within an agile environment and contributing to continuous improvement of our processes
  • Contributing to backlog grooming in close collaboration with the Business Analyst

As our new Back End Developer, you’ll have:

  • Previous backend coding experience: Java, Golang, C++
  • Knowledge of Docker and related container-orchestration technologies (e.g. Kubernetes)
  • Previous experience developing in high-speed low latency environments
  • Experience in developing and managing systems using cloud computing products (AWS)
  • Strong understanding of design and development principles, and best practice in fundamental programming techniques and concepts
  • Strong experience in Agile development, familiarity with CD/DI and an agile team environment/tools (Jira/Trello)

It’s desirable (but not essential!) that you have these:

  • Some experience with and understanding of frontend technologies (React)
  • Previous experience with Trading platforms and architectures (ideally!)
  • Confidence that you can learn new things quickly
  • An education of some kind
  • A sense of humor
  • Curiosity

Perks & Benefits:

  • Highly competitive salary
  • Genuinely collaborative and friendly culture
  • Flexible working arrangements – we value work-life balance
  • Generous parental leave policy
  • Ongoing Personal Development & Training
  • Employee Assistance Program
  • Frequent team events and celebrations

About Pepperstone

Pepperstone is an online Forex and CFD Broker providing traders across the globe with cutting-edge technology to trade the world’s markets. Our award-winning combination of outstanding customer service coupled with incredibly low-cost pricing across all FX, CFDs, and Commodities has resulted in Pepperstone being one of the world’s fastest-growing FX brokers. Our focus is to support every one of our customers’ quests for trading mastery.

Please express your interest by applying through our Pepperstone Careers page as soon as possible! https://pepperstonecareers.com/

Pepperstone is an equal opportunity employer.